Sheringham Primary School Year 1 and 2 pupils had all the right ingredients for the perfect festive show, in a modern-day take on the nativity entitled Christmas Recipe.
Performed at St Peter's Church, the musical play followed the Key Stage 2 show, Straw and Order, which was staged in the school hall earlier in the week.
Headteacher Sue Brady thanked staff and parents for their help in putting on the show, as well as Charles Sanders, of Sanders Coaches, who laid on transport for the children.
A retiring collection raised cash for St Peter's and the children's charity SOS Africa.
